I am a week away from my 69th birthday and after a few dismal failures many years ago, I have never attempted making my own pie dough. Until now. For Christmas dinner this year, my youngest son requested pecan pie for dessert instead of our traditional trifle. I had watched this video and thoought: why not. It turned out better than I imagined it would, although there were a couple challenges: like getting the rolled dough into the pie plate. I think I did not mix the butter long enough. Still, it was the best pecan pie I've ever made. Also the only one. The crust was definiitely tender and flaky, and the filling a gorgeous balance of nutty and smooth and just as you promised: not too sweet - just right. I intend to practice and bake more pies now, because you have shown me it's much easier than I believed. One is never too old to learn a new skill - as I taught my kids, fail means first attempt is learning. You should know that you were a part of our Christmas this year, and may be responsible for a new family Christmas tradition. Thanks Anna.

What can be used in place of the corn syrup as this isn’t readily available in Australia?
@stooge812 жыл бұрын
Golden syrup (ex: Lyle's) should be an acceptable substitute and actually a little less cloying than corn syrup.
